Ohio to Adopt a Less Stringent CIPA
News | www.schoollibraryjournal.com | Apr 1, 2004
Thanks to support from local librarians, the Ohio state legislature is about to pass its own version of the federal Children's Internet Protection Act (CIPA)—one that will allow kids to surf the Net filter-free if they're engaged in legitimate research.
